Flamengo’s Lawyer Questions Bruno Henrique’s Suspension and Details Appeal Process

As reported by SporTV, Michel Assef Filho, the lawyer for Bruno Henrique and Flamengo, disputed claims that the striker’s 12-game suspension for betting-related misconduct was “lenient.” The suspension also includes a fine of 60,000 reais, which the defense believes is excessive.

Assef stated, “There’s been a lot of talk about the punishment being mild. What happened with Bruno Henrique is different from previous cases. He shouldn’t have been punished under Article 243-A, which aims to prevent fraud in the game. In other instances, players manipulated results, but Bruno just intended to take a third yellow card, which is part of game strategy.”

He expressed concern over the idea that the sanction was too light, calling it actually exaggerated. “There was no privileged information or match-fixing involved,” he added.

The defense plans to appeal to the full panel of the STJD on two points: seeking recognition of the statute of limitations and disputing the use of Article 243-A. The lawyers argue that Bruno Henrique’s actions did not show unethical or anticompetitive conduct.

Currently, the suspension applies to Brazilian league matches, unless the Prosecutor’s Office asks for it to extend to other competitions. Meanwhile, a Federal District court reaffirmed its decision not to prosecute the player for fraud, due to a lack of evidence. Judge Fernando Brandini Barbagalo stated that only the charge of sports fraud remains, dismissing a proposed multimillion-real bond.

The case is now headed to a higher court. Bruno Henrique, along with his brother and seven others, was accused of announcing before a match against Santos in November 2023 that he planned to receive a yellow card, while he was already on two cautions in the league.
